El Camino Cantina, The Rocks

El Camino Cantina brings Tex-Mex with a whole lot of rock and roll attitude to Sydney.

Taking up residence at the former site of Ananas, as the latter is on the move to Darling Harbour, El Camino Cantina has a touch of the Austin, Texas cantinas about it. From the neon lit restaurant, shiny topped diner stools, a couple of 1957 Chevy trunks with serve yourself fresh salsas and chips plus plenty of rock and roll music and videos. In the space near the kitchen you can take a seat where number plates, Mexican iconography and half face/half skull Day of the Dead style artworks of long and recently lost musical legends adorn the walls.

The menu offers from light bites, think nachos and tacos with fillings of marinated barbacoa pork and lobster to name a few through to enchiladas and sizzling fajitas. More substantial dishes from the grill like Carne Asada, wagyu beef steak with a lime and pepper marinade and the El Camino steak which is the Carne Asada topped with jalapeños and melted jack cheese.

The bar has margaritas in classic, mango and strawberry either on the rocks or frozen to enjoy. There is a specialty cocktail list that is all about tequila which is no surprise as there is a list of over 200 tequilas and mezcals on the back bar to try. Add to this a selection of Mexican beers plus some local craft beers and you have plenty to settle back with.

El Camino Cantina is all about having fun. So grab some friends and head down for tasty food, music and margaritas with a touch of madness.
